From 18 to 20 August 2026, Portugal will once again be represented at Intertextile Shanghai Home Textiles, one of the world's leading trade fairs dedicated to home textiles. For the second consecutive edition, the Portuguese delegation will be showcased through the Home from Portugal (HfP) institutional stand, reinforcing the country's collective strategy to promote the excellence of its home textile industry in one of the world's most dynamic and strategic markets.
